Thumbs up 6637 mod

Thinking of doing 6637 mod.....just a few ???'s What about a cover..do I need a sock or something for it ? All the pics I see show an exposed filter. What about water on or around . If i wanted to wash under the hood ?( not that I ever had before ). I see alot of pro's ...what about the cons... noise is not issue... I'd love to hear the turbo more and I'll turn up the Radio more when needed. Please let me know...thx.

For a cover you could also do the "pop mod" https://www.ford-trucks.com/forums/4...637-cover.html . If you wanted to wash under the hood you would want to remove the filter before hand. But when you washing under there its allways good to remove some things that get in the way, or mght get damaged by water. Oh and you'll love to hear that turbo sing, its a nice added bonus.

Definitely do the $20 big 6637 filter on your truck,it'll breathe mucho better.

I place a plastic bag over the element when cleaning under the hood for protecting from water splash but getting an outerwears pre filter is the way to go to catch larger dirt particles first.

You can run a cover if you want but its not really needed in my experience. as far as water when washing my engine compartment (yes I do it regularly) I just use a plastic sheet of some sort and just wrap it around the filter and wash away. If napa is still get the filter from donaldson as my last filter was it had a "duralite" sticker on it which is donaldson's patented filter media that is water repellant and sheds water very well.
